Coordinates, directs and manages the office of a top university executive.
- Coordinates and manages the daily schedule of the university executive with internal and external parties, which includes staff, university administrators, alumni, students, Board of Regents, government officials and community leaders.
- Maintains appointment/meeting schedule and calendar.
- Makes travel arrangements, screens all in-coming telephone calls, and sorts and prioritizes mail.
- Drafts routine responses to correspondence as needed.
- Functionally supervises projects in the office of the executive.
- Collects and prepares information for use in discussions and meetings with executive staff members and outside individuals.
- May supervise secretarial and clerical staff in the office.
- Performs other job-related duties as assigned.

Bachelors and 5 years experience
Requires a thorough understanding of both theoretical and practical aspects of an analytical, technical or professional discipline; or the basic knowledge of more than one professional discipline. Knowledge of the discipline is normally obtained through a formal, directly job-related 4 year degree from a college or university or an equivalent in-depth specialized training program that is directly related to the type of work being performed. Requires a minimum of five (5) years of directly job-related experience.
